EP3C55F484C6N Power Cycling: Common Reasons and Quick Fixes
Introduction: Power cycling issues in the EP3C55F484C6N FPGA ( Field Programmable Gate Array ) device can be disruptive to your system's performance. Power cycling refers to the process where the device repeatedly powers on and off or resets unexpectedly, often leading to instability or failure to function correctly. This problem can stem from various causes, such as hardware issues, power supply irregularities, or configuration errors. Below is a guide to understanding common reasons for power cycling and step-by-step instructions for troubleshooting and resolving the issue.
Common Reasons for Power Cycling in EP3C55F484C6N:
Power Supply Issues: Reason: The EP3C55F484C6N requires stable and consistent power supply voltages. If there are fluctuations, under-voltage, or over-voltage conditions, the FPGA may not receive proper power, triggering power cycling. Cause: The power supply might not be able to provide sufficient or stable voltage, or there may be issues with the power delivery system (e.g., incorrect voltage rails, poor connections, or faulty components). Faulty Connections: Reason: Loose or damaged wiring and connectors can lead to intermittent power issues. Cause: Bad solder joints, corroded pins, or broken traces on the PCB can cause a loss of electrical contact, triggering the FPGA to reset. Overheating: Reason: If the device gets too hot, it may enter a safe mode by power cycling to prevent damage. Cause: Inadequate cooling or high ambient temperatures can lead to overheating. The FPGA might initiate a reset to protect itself from thermal stress. Incorrect Configuration or Programming: Reason: If the FPGA is not correctly configured or programmed, it can lead to instability and power cycling. Cause: A faulty bitstream file, corrupted configuration data, or improper initialization sequence may cause the device to repeatedly reset. External Interference: Reason: Electromagnetic interference ( EMI ) or noisy signals can cause unexpected resets in the FPGA. Cause: External devices or signals affecting the FPGA’s operation could trigger power cycling as the FPGA tries to reset to avoid errors.Step-by-Step Troubleshooting Guide for Power Cycling:
1. Check Power Supply Voltage: Action: Use a multimeter or oscilloscope to check the voltage levels being supplied to the FPGA. Ensure that they match the required specifications. Solution: If there are voltage irregularities, replace or repair the power supply. Check the power rails for stability and correct output. Make sure there are no short circuits or issues with power delivery components like Capacitors and inductors. 2. Inspect Connections and Solder Joints: Action: Visually inspect the FPGA board, connectors, and cables. Look for any loose connections, damaged pins, or broken traces on the PCB. Solution: Reflow solder joints if needed, repair any broken traces, or replace damaged connectors or cables. Ensure the FPGA is securely mounted in its socket. 3. Monitor Temperature: Action: Measure the temperature around the FPGA using a thermal camera or temperature probe. Solution: If the device is overheating, check the cooling solution. Ensure that fans, heatsinks, or thermal pads are properly installed. If necessary, enhance the cooling system or move the FPGA to a cooler environment. 4. Verify Configuration and Bitstream: Action: Ensure that the FPGA's configuration bitstream is correctly programmed and not corrupted. You can reload the bitstream using a programming tool or verify the integrity of the configuration file. Solution: Reprogram the FPGA with a known good bitstream file. Ensure that the bitstream is correctly designed for the EP3C55F484C6N and that all required initialization sequences are correct. 5. Eliminate External Interference: Action: Check if other devices nearby may be emitting electromagnetic interference or noisy signals that could affect the FPGA. Solution: Relocate the FPGA to a different, less noisy environment. Shield the FPGA with EMI protective enclosures or use proper grounding techniques to minimize the impact of external interference.Additional Tips:
Check for Firmware or Software Updates: Sometimes, firmware or software bugs can cause power cycling. Ensure that your FPGA development tools are up-to-date, as newer versions may fix known issues.
Test with a Different Power Supply: If you're unsure whether the power supply is the issue, test with a different, reliable power source to see if the problem persists.
Use capacitor s for Stability: Adding decoupling capacitors close to the power pins of the FPGA can help smooth out power fluctuations and improve stability.
Consult EP3C55F484C6N Datasheet: Always refer to the official datasheet for the exact power requirements, temperature ranges, and electrical characteristics of the device.
Conclusion:
Power cycling in the EP3C55F484C6N FPGA can be caused by various factors, including power supply issues, faulty connections, overheating, improper configuration, or external interference. By following the above troubleshooting steps—checking power supply voltage, inspecting connections, monitoring temperature, verifying configuration, and addressing external interference—you can systematically identify and resolve the cause of power cycling. Make sure to apply each fix carefully, and if the issue persists, consider consulting the manufacturer's technical support for further assistance.